Teenagers cleared of murdering 15-year-old boy in sword attack
- Two teenagers (now 16 and 17) were found not guilty of murdering 15‑year‑old Amen Teklay after a Glasgow trial over a March 2025 sword stabbing.
- The prosecution called it a "murderous assault," but the younger defendant said he acted in self‑defence amid a long‑running feud involving weapons, while the older boy denied attacking Amen.
- The trial featured CCTV, messages and emotional scenes in court, and Amen’s death prompted a local vigil and memorial.
